DIY Wreath from Individual Stamp Elements

Rather than use the autumn entwined floral wreath by Barbara Gray (Claritystamp) itself on this card, I decided to build up my own wreath using the extra stamps which come with the set.
Trim a piece of Clarity stencil card to 6.5” x 6.5”. Draw round the inner circle stencil from the Framer 1 set lightly in pencil in the centre. Stamp the berry branch from the Barbara’s entwined autumn wreath stamp set six times around the circle in Olympia Green Versafine ink.
Add the fern stamp nine times around the circle in Spanish Moss Versafine ink.
Add the leaf pair outline between the berry branches in the same ink. When dry, erase the pencil circle.
Colour the leaves, berries and ferns using coloured pencils.
Add Happy Birthday using the sentiments which come with the floral numbers to the centre of the wreath. Use Versamark ink and heat emboss with copper embossing powder.
Colour the lettering with a red Sakura Stardust pen. Go over the berries with the same pen.
To finish, add the topper to the front of a 7” x 7” black card blank.
